  • Human-in-the-loop (HITL) in LangGraph is a mechanism that allows pausing graph execution to request human intervention, enabling validation, approval, or adjustment of decisions before the flow continues.   • LangGraph is a framework designed for building complex graph-based workflows, enabling the explicit modeling of systems with multiple steps and decision points. Unlike traditional linear flows, it uses nodes (execution units) and edges (transitions between nodes) to define system behavior.
